TiRh₃ is an intermetallic compound combining titanium and rhodium, belonging to the family of transition metal intermetallics. This material is primarily investigated in research and aerospace contexts for its potential to provide high-temperature strength and stiffness while maintaining structural stability in demanding thermal environments. The titanium-rhodium system is of particular interest for applications requiring exceptional hardness and elastic properties at elevated temperatures, though commercial deployment remains limited compared to conventional titanium alloys and nickel-based superalloys.
